Desks

The place where you sit down to work, pay bills, or just catch up with social media should be comfortable, and it doesn't hurt if it's beautiful, too. Mainly, your desk needs to be a place where you can focus on the task at hand, whatever that may be. Here's what to look for while you shop.
First, you'll need to ask yourself how large of a desk you need. If you just need a place to set your laptop while you write a few emails and check your bank balance, then a small writing desk or secretary will be enough. If you have a desktop computer with a printer, speakers, and other components, you'll need something larger. If you like to have your reference materials nearby, choose something with shelves, drawers, or a hutch.
Next, the room where you'll set up your home office will need to factor into your decision. Large workstations are great for dividing up larger rooms while corner desks are ideal for focusing your thoughts in a cozy room. If the room will be your dedicated home office, then choose something with a bold style and decorate around it. If you're adding a home office area to another room, coordinate the finish and the details with the existing furniture there. A desk with doors may be helpful in a room like this, too, so you can close everything up when you're not working.
Finally, you'll need to think about who will use the desk most. If your inner entrepreneur is telling you to be your own boss, then it could be time to start shopping for home office furniture. Choose a desk that inspires you, whether it's the style that gets your creativity going or just the space to spread out your things. If you're setting up a study space for your child, look for a student desk that has room for a computer as well as an open textbook. If you do a lot of typing, you may want to look for something that comes with a keyboard tray.
